Glenn Greenwald reacts to the killing of two Israeli Embassy staffers in D.C. and explains how the tragedy is being politicized and weaponized against free speech in the United States.
---------
Watch full episodes on Rumble, streamed LIVE 7pm ET.
Become part of our Locals community
Follow System Update: